Redcar East Station is a basic facility that focuses on essentials to cater to its travellers. Though there isn't a ticket office available, you can conveniently collect your pre-booked tickets from the ticket machines on site. Remember though, if accessibility is a concern, note that these machines are not accessible to all. However, the station does support hearing-impaired passengers with an induction loop system.
While the station might not boast restrooms or waiting rooms, there's a secure provision for bicycle storage. You have the option of lockers or stands for well-kept bikes, with CCTV ensuring surveillance. For those looking to hire bikes, unfortunately, this amenity is not offered at the station.
Getting in and out of Redcar East is quite straightforward with several transport links. The rail replacement service offers pick-up and drop-off at the bus stop right under the railway bridge, a perfect convenience if you're heading to Middlesbrough or Saltburn. Although the station has no cab rank, taxi services are accessible via Cab4You. For bus enthusiasts, there's a nearby stop, and you can reach out to Busline at 0871 200 2233 for more information.

Westerton is equipped with essential amenities to enhance your travel experience. The ticket office is operational from 6:30 am to 20:50 on weekdays and Saturdays, and a bit shorter on Sundays opening from 9:10 am to 16:50. Ticket machines are accessible, allowing you to collect tickets bought online. The station supports smartcard validators for easy check-in and check-out.
For those requiring additional assistance, Westerton caters with step-free access throughout its premises, making it an accessible Category A station. Passengers can use ramps for a seamless journey to and from trains. Help points are available for customer assistance, making sure everyone feels supported.
While the station might lack some amenities like cafes, shops, and ATM machines, it compensates with free parking space available 24/7, and secure bicycle storage with 12 stands. Remember, if you need to use the toilets, they are open upon request during the ticket office’s operating hours.
Navigating onward from Westerton is straightforward with various options available. For those needing a rail replacement service, buses can be found at the Maxwell Avenue station car park turning circle. Taxis can be booked via train taxi service, providing a convenient onward journey.
If buses are your preference, visit Travel Line Scotland or call their 24-hour line at 0871 200 22 33 for service details. These options ensure you're connected to your next destination with ease.
